WebJul 3, 2024 · How to Convert Molecules to Moles. To go from moles to molecules, multiply the number of moles by 6.02 x 10 23. WebMar 31, 2024 · Multiply the relative atomic mass by the molar mass constant. This is defined as 0.001 kilogram per mole, or 1 gram per mole. This converts atomic units to grams per mole, making the molar mass of hydrogen 1.007 grams per mole, of carbon 12.0107 grams per mole, of oxygen 15.9994 grams per mole, and of chlorine 35.453 grams per mole. … Web1 mole of a number =Avogadro’s constant N A. After calculating the number of moles, the number of molecules will be equal to the product of the number of moles and Avogadro’s number, given by; Number of ions= (number of moles)X N A ( 6. 022 × 10 23) ( ∴ N A = Avogadro’s number)
